Functional Description, continued.
Ni-Cad battery packs can be re-charged ‘in-situ’ and do not need to be removed from the controller
housing. To enable such battery charging to be carried out, a series of optional battery chargers are
available for all CATTRON-THEIMEG
PS controllers. One end of the charger is connected to the
mains power outlet, the other plugs into a covered socket located within the bottom end cap. Additional
options include an ‘AAA’ size battery adapter, and an external battery-charging unit refer to
accessories/consumable items in Section 6 for details and part numbers.
A shoulder-carrying strap is standard for all CATTRON-THEIMEG
PS controllers. This is quickly
and simply installed to a pair of ‘D’-rings located on the side of the controller.
Specifications.
Case Material:
Extreme duty, dust and water resistant, aluminum housing.
Approximate weight:
2.3lbs. / 1.04 Kg (including battery pack)
Dimensions:
12.0" x 3.0" x 2.0" (30.0cm x 7.6cm x 5.1cm).
Environmental:
Consult CATTRON-THEIMEG
factory for a wide range of environmental solutions.
Maximum Functions:
Up to 20 operator commands, depending on controller configuration.
Operator Control Functions PSAT Series:
Up to six large pushbuttons (proportional type, three-step type, or any combination of
these two), plus additional toggle switches and/or pushbuttons, as required.
